I find it absolutely unbelievable. I appreciate we will have plenty of time to flesh this out this evening but I find it very disturbing that it is fair enough to get stuck into a campaign as a constituency issue for a child who is clearly identified but when the Government has a chance to regularise the situation for children who do not need to be deported and who may be deported it turns its back on them in the most callous fashion. It backed the referendum in 2004, which was wrong. The Labour Party along with Sinn Féin, the Green Party and others campaigned against the referendum.
